Gross enrolment ratio, upper secondary, both sexes in Myanmar
Myanmar: Gross enrolment ratio, upper secondary, both sexes was 54.4% in 2018. ▲ Rising
Gross enrolment ratio, upper secondary, both sexes in Myanmar, 1999–2018
Source: UNESCO Institute for Statistics. Measured in %.
Analysis
Myanmar recorded 54.4% for gross enrolment ratio, upper secondary, both sexes in 2018. That is the highest value across all 16 years on record.
The figure is up 10.5% on the previous year and up 49.3% over ten years.
Over the whole period, gross enrolment ratio, upper secondary, both sexes in Myanmar peaked at 54.4% in 2018 and was at its lowest, 26.1%, in 1999.
Myanmar ranks 134th of 182 countries on this measure, in the middle of the range.
The long-run direction has been consistently rising across the 16 years of available data.
Gross enrolment ratio, upper secondary, both sexes in Myanmar, year by year
| Year | % | Change |
|---|---|---|
| 1999 | 26.1% | — |
| 2000 | 30.3% | +15.7% |
| 2001 | 30.2% | -0.1% |
| 2002 | 30.9% | +2.4% |
| 2003 | 31.3% | +1.2% |
| 2004 | 32.7% | +4.4% |
| 2005 | 33.3% | +1.7% |
| 2006 | 34.2% | +2.7% |
| 2007 | 33.4% | -2.4% |
| 2008 | 36.5% | +9.3% |
| 2009 | 35.7% | -2.0% |
| 2010 | 35.0% | -2.1% |
| 2014 | 34.3% | -2.0% |
| 2016 | 44.4% | +29.5% |
| 2017 | 49.3% | +11.0% |
| 2018 | 54.4% | +10.5% |

About this data
Total enrollment in upper secondary education, regardless of age, expressed as a percentage of the total population of official upper secondary education age.
